Rubber ro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a rubber roofing system to ident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. During an inspection, trained service providers examine the roof’s surface for signs of damage, such as cracks, tears, or punctures, as well as checking the integrity of seams and flashing. They may also evaluate drainage systems and look for areas where water could pool or leak. Regular inspections help homeowners maintain the longevity of their rubber roofs by catching problems early, ensuring that minor issues don’t escalate into major repairs or replacements.
This service is particularly valuable for addressing common problems that can compromise the effectiveness of a rubber roof. Over time, exposure to weather elements like wind, hail, and UV rays can cause the material to weaken or develop cracks. Vegetation, debris, or standing water can also contribute to deterioration or mold growth. Inspections help pinpoint these issues before they lead to leaks or structural damage, allowing property owners to schedule necessary repairs promptly. Detecting early signs of wear can extend the lifespan of the roof and prevent unexpected failures that disrupt daily life.

The overview below groups typical Rubber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Shawano,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or rubber roof repairs in Shawano often range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le band, covering small leaks or patching damaged areas. Fewer projects tend to push into the higher end of this range.
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, such as replacing large sections or addressing multiple issues, generally cost between $600-$1,500. These projects are common for medium-sized roofs or multiple problem areas needing attention.
Full Roof Inspection - A comprehensive inspection usually costs between $150-$400. Many local contractors offer this service as a standard part of maintenance, with costs remaining fairly consistent across different properties.
Full Roof Replacement - Replacing an entire rubber roof can range from $5,000-$12,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more complex installations tend to reach the upper end of this range, while smaller homes typically fall toward the lower end.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in a rubber roof inspection? A rubber roof inspection typically includes checking for signs of damage, such as cracks, punctures, or blisters, and assessing the overall condition of the roofing material.
How can a roof inspection help my rubber roof? An inspection can identify potential issues early, helping to prevent leaks and costly repairs by addressing problems before they worsen.
Who should perform a rubber roof inspection? Local contractors experienced with rubber roofing can handle inspections thoroughly and accurately, ensuring all areas are properly evaluated.
What are common issues found during rubber roof inspections? Common issues include membrane tears, pooling water, seam separation, and signs of weather-related wear or damage.
When should I schedule a rubber roof inspection? It’s advisable to have a roof inspected periodically, especially after severe weather or if you notice signs of damage or leaks in your building.
